The lung is a complex, branched organ that follows an intricate and well-coordinated developmental process to generate dozens of different cell types. Several protocols have been established to differentiate stem cells into the cell types of the lung in culture, to complement studies in animals aimed at understanding the basic processes of lung development, homeostasis, and response to injury.
